To reinstall, download the duo Station application file from support.dell.com or from My Dell Downloads at DownloadStore.dell.com. 28 The duo Station interface is corrupt or has some files missing. • Try launching the application manually. Solving Problems duo Station Problems If the duo Station interface does not launch as soon as you dock the tablet - Click Start → All Programs→ Dell→ duo Station. • Reinstall the duo Station interface.

Specifications This section provides information about the specifications for your dock. NOTE: Offerings may vary by region. Device Information Inspiron duo Audio Station Connectors Audio Network adapter one audio-out/ headphone connector one RJ45 connector USB Media Card Reader two 4-pin USB 2.0-compliant connectors one 7-in-1 slot Media Card Reader Cards supported Secure Digital (SD) memory card Secure Digital High Capacity (SDHC) memory card Secure Digital Extended Capacity (SDXC) memory card Multimedia Card plus (MMC+) Memory Stick Memory Stick PRO xD-Picture Card 29
